
With the tool, Google delivers up to 14 sponsored listings from insurers with rate quote information (it’s likely that number will increase as the program expands).
Users can buy policies online or by calling an agent from their phones. MetLife and Mercury Insurance are among the initial advertisers.
Launching in California to start, the program will roll out to more states with additional features such as ratings and reviews and local agent support for insurance companies with agent networks.
Google will act as the lead generator rather than mere ad facilitator with pricing based on "a flexible cost-per-acquisition (CPA) model".
